Nuttall Park celebrates 80th birthday
Date published: 04/07/2008
The Friends of Nuttall Park and Bury Ranger Service have organized the 'Nuttall
Extravaganza' to celebrate the park's eightieth birthday.
The event will take place on Saturday 12 July between 12.30 and 5pm. There will
be a variety of activities on offer to suit every age group, including; story
tellers, live bands, fairground and craft stalls, a Hawk and Owl display, a
BBQ, cream teas and a refreshments stall selling Bury Black Pudding.
The new Ranger Base at the park will also be opened at the event and a new
commemorative stone, donated by Marshalls, will be also be unveiled.
Amy Leach, Ranger for Ramsbottom said; "Local businesses and voluntary groups
have got involved with the planning and organisation of the event and it
couldn't have gone ahead without their help. The birthday event is to celebrate
the park being given to Ramsbottom eighty years ago so I hope everyone will
come along to celebrate".
